For more than 15 years, Andy Hamelsky has helped clients achieve results by getting to the heart of each case using an aggressive, hands-on and responsive approach. Practicing from the firm’s New York and New Jersey offices, Andy has been applying his result-oriented style in his representation of insurance companies and corporate clients in both jurisdictions.
He concentrates his practice on representing life, health and disability insurers statewide and regionally, in a wide range of matters. He routinely represents his clients in a variety of ERISA and non-ERISA matters, including institutional pattern and practice bad faith cases. In addition to his first-party insurance practice, Andy handles negligence actions, commercial litigation actions, FINRA arbitrations and a wide array of other commercial litigation matters.
Andy is a member of the Defense Research Institute and is vice-chair of the Life, Health and Disability Committee and Webinar Committee. He is a past chair of the group's Expert Committee. He is often invited to speak at industry-related events and has written articles for various publications, including Mealey's Report and DRI.
